How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Dallas County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Dallas County Studio Apartments | $1,393 | $556 | $10,000+ |
| Dallas County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,536 | $575 | $10,000+ |
| Dallas County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,073 | $669 | $10,000+ |
| Dallas County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,771 | $765 | $10,000+ |
| Dallas County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,036 | $1,259 | $10,000+ |
| Dallas County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$10,887 | $2,395 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Senior Dallas County Apartments
What is the Cheapest Senior apartment in Dallas County?
Currently the most affordable Senior Apartment in Dallas County is at Estates at Shiloh listed at $556.
How much is the average rent for a Senior Dallas County Apartment?
The average rent for a Senior Apartment in Dallas County is $1,460.
What is the largest Senior Dallas County Apartment for rent?
Today's Senior apartment with the most square footage in Dallas County is a 1,313 square feet unit starting from $623 at Pegasus Senior Villas.
What is the average size for Dallas County Senior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Senior rental in Dallas County is currently at 644 sq ft.
